以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  目录树生成新版是否有BUG  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=87148)

--  作者:凡夫俗子
--  发布时间:2016/7/4 21:52:00
--  目录树生成新版是否有BUG

图片点击可在新窗口打开查看此主题相关图片如下:qq图片20160704214901.png
图片点击可在新窗口打开查看



图片点击可在新窗口打开查看此主题相关图片如下:qq图片20160704215140.png
图片点击可在新窗口打开查看


生成语句为:

Dim tr As WinForm.TreeView = e.Form.Controls("TreeView1")
Dim nd As WinForm.TreeNode
tr.StopRedraw()
tr.Nodes.Clear
Dim DataTableName As String = "DataStandard"
Dim Columns  As String = "BigClass_名称|DropDownClass|DropDownName"
Dim Filter As String = ""
Dim Sort As String = ""        \'"DataId"   加上这个排序语句 则出现不正常。这个指示为录入顺序。
Dim mj As Boolean = True
Dim js As Integer
tr.BuildTree(DataTableName, Columns, Filter, Sort)
tr.Nodes.Insert("无",0)
\'tr.ExpandAll
tr.ResumeRedraw()
[此贴子已经被作者于2016/7/4 21:54:30编辑过]

--  作者:大红袍
--  发布时间:2016/7/4 21:54:00
--  

 排序,要和分组一致,比如

 

trv.BuildTree("表A", "第一列|第二列|第三列", "", "第一列,_Sortkey,_Identify")

[此贴子已经被作者于2016/7/4 21:53:56编辑过]